Terherne, De Fryske Marren
NeighbourhoodThis detached house on Buorren sits in the heart of Terherne, a village surrounded by water and wide skies. With 211 m² of living space and a generous 710 m² plot, it offers plenty of room for a family or anyone who loves space. The home dates from 1921 but has an A energy label, so it is both characterful and efficient. At €1,200,000, the price is on the high side compared to other detached houses in De Fryske Marren, but the size and location justify it.
Terherne is a small village with about 720 residents, known for its lakes and marinas. It is a quiet place where many people live in detached homes, 98% of the housing stock is single-family. The population is older on average, with a third of residents over 65. There are no neighbourhood reviews available, but the village has a strong community feel. The neighbourhood Terherne is a peaceful spot for those who enjoy nature and water sports.
For your daily shopping, the nearest supermarket is Poiesz, about 3.7 km away, a short drive. There is also a Jumbo and an Albert Heijn within 7 km. Right next door, at just 45 metres, is Samenlevingsschool Bloei, a primary school with 44 pupils. Other schools are further afield, in Akkrum. The municipality De Fryske Marren covers a large area, so amenities are spread out, but the village itself has a restaurant just 0.3 km away.

About Buorren 68, Terherne
The price is on the high side for a detached house in De Fryske Marren, but the home is large (211 m²) and sits on a 710 m² plot. It also has an A energy label, which is excellent for a 1921 property. Whether it is fair depends on how much you value space and a waterside village location.
The home has an A energy label, meaning it is very energy-efficient. For a house built in 1921, this is unusual and suggests significant modernisation, such as insulation and efficient heating. You can expect relatively low energy costs.
The nearest train station is 5.9 km away. That is about a 10-minute drive or a 20-minute bike ride. The station connects to the wider rail network, but specific destinations are not listed.
The closest school is Samenlevingsschool Bloei, a primary school just 45 metres away on the same street. Other primary schools are in Akkrum, about 4.5 km away. For secondary education, the nearest school is 10.1 km away, so a longer commute is needed.
The nearest supermarket is Poiesz, 3.7 km away, too far to walk comfortably but a short drive. For more choice, Jumbo, Lidl and Albert Heijn are within 7 km. Daily shopping is best done by car or bike.
Terherne is a very quiet village with only 11 recorded crimes in total. That is extremely low, so the area feels safe. The village has a small population of 720, and most homes are owner-occupied.
